Abstract :
Time Reversal (TR) is a well known simple time/spatial refocusing based on the time invariance of wave equation in lossless media, which is performed in a two phases process (M. Fink, IEEE Trans. Ultrason. Ferroelec. Freq. Contr., 39, 1992, pp. 555–566). The first (sensing) step consists in sensing the field radiated by a point source located in the point where one wants to refocus the field. In the second (back-propagation) step, the signal collected by a set of receivers (Time Reversal Mirror) is time reversed and back-propagated. By virtue of the time invariance of the wave equation which governs the propagation phenomenon, the wave will undergoes the same path focusing in the point where the original point source was located.
